History of Sleep Disorders in Chronic Kidney Disease: First Approach.

Rosa Maria De SantoBiagio Raffaele Di Iorio
Published in: Experimental and clinical transplantation : official journal of the Middle East Society for Organ Transplantation (2023)
Sleep disorders affect most patients with chronic kidney disease. No ascertained pharmacological therapy exists, and even a successful transplant does not totally restore a refreshing sleep. Longer nocturnal hemodialysis is of benefit. Sleep apnea may be cured with continuous positive airway pressure.
